Example #1
0
 public function testSettingDeclaredAttributeOnBehavior()
 {
     $subject = new ExampleExtendableClass();
     $behavior = $subject->getClassExtension('ExampleBehaviorClass1');
     $subject->behaviorAttribute = 'Test';
     $this->assertEquals('Test', $subject->behaviorAttribute);
     $this->assertEquals('Test', $behavior->behaviorAttribute);
     $this->assertTrue($subject->isClassExtendedWith('ExampleBehaviorClass1'));
 }